2025W07 Weekly report => 10/02 2K25 - 16/02 2K25 MalSpam campaigns targeting Italy


Malware spread through the campaigns: AgentTesla, BluStealer, LokiBot, Remcos, VIPKeylogger
       
week07

Weekly report by TG Soft's CRAM, concerning Italian malspam campaigns.

Below the details of the campaigns massively spread during the week from
February 10 to February 16, 2025.

In the monitored week, both global campaigns and campaigns in Italian declined compared to the previous week


The week was characterized by Password Stealer of the Familiies:
AgentTesla, BluStealer, LokiBot, Remcos and VIPKeylogger.

The blue bar shows the total number of campaigns monitored in Italy in each week, while the red bar concerns campaigns in Italian (and targeting Italy).

We monitored 33
campaigns during the week, 6 of which used Italian as their language.

During the week, the peak in global campaigns was found on Monday, February 10 with 13 different campaigns per day. The peak of campaigns  in Italian was also found on Monday, February 10 with 4 campaigns per day, as highlighted by the graph below:



In the following chart we see the malware families spread globally for each day in the week:



Instead in this graph we see the distribution based on malware family. In the past week 9 different families were detected::


The featured samples this week are MSIL executables with 45.46% of the malware sent via e-mail.
In second place are WIN32 executables with 24.24%.
As for third and fourth place, there are AutoIT executables and Script files (JS, VBS, PS, HTML, Link, etc.) with 12.12% tied.

The Italian campaigns analyzed by TG Soft's C.R.A.M. were grouped according to macro categories, obtained from the subject of the email message used for malware distribution (malspam). Below we see the subjects used in the various campaigns divided by day and type of malware.
 


10/02/2025
AgentTesla spread through a campaign themed "Payments".
BluStealer spread through a campaign themed "Orders".
Remcos spread through a campaign themed "Ordinances".
VIPKeylogger spread through a campaign themed "Payments".

11/02/2025
LokiBot spread through a campaign themed "Orders".

13/02/2025
AgentTesla spread through a campaign themed "Orders".
